Best Schools in Little Flock, AR
Little Flock, AR has a total of 12 schools including 3 high schools, 4 middle schools and 5 elementary schools. A total of 11,132 students attend Little Flock, AR schools. On average, schools in Little Flock score 43%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 41%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Little Flock exceed exp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Little Flock, AR
City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.
Community Factors
Little Flock, AR has a total population of 4,847 with 19%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 90%, and 37%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
